# Sproutline Scheduler — Environments

Sproutline runs in three environments: dev (shared sandbox, resets nightly), staging (mirrors prod greenhouse topology), and prod (live watering schedules for the Fennwick sites). Releases promote dev → staging → prod; staging must soak 24h. Valve-timing changes require sign-off from the horticulture lead. Staging uses synthetic moisture feeds, so alerts there are informational only. For reference, the current production environment runs with the following configuration.

deployment values, kajep-kageg:
[praix]
host = praix.paliqcorp.corp
user = praix_svc
database = praix_prod

Ticket: Vault lockout blocking idempotency key rotation — Paylume retries service

The Kestrel vault sealed itself after three failed unseal attempts during the idempotency key rotation for payment retries. Without access, the retries worker cannot mint new keys, so duplicate charge protection is running on the stale keyset. Risk is low for 24 hours but grows after that. We verified the rotation script itself is sound; only vault access is blocked. For the security review, the recovery passphrase needed to unseal is below.

vault phrase of kafog-kahif = holdor-rusir-praox

# Zero-downtime schema migrations for the Quillbarn release pipeline.
# All migrations must be expand/contract: add new columns first, backfill
# in batches of 5,000 rows, then drop old columns only after two full
# release cycles. Never run a contract step during peak hours. The
# migration runner verifies lock timeouts before each step and aborts
# on contention. It reads its target database from the line below.

primary connection of yagep-kahip = redis://giliel_svc:zYiKsLL2PLpfPL@db-348f.xolmarsys.corp:5432/fenwyn

The updated sales-commission scheme at Quandrel Goods takes effect next quarter. Base commission drops from 6% to 4.5%, offset by a tiered accelerator above 110% of target. Modelling by the Harwick finance group shows top performers net slightly more; mid-band sellers break roughly even. Branch managers should expect questions about clawback rules, which now apply to cancellations within 90 days. Payout timing moves to monthly. The strategic reasoning behind these changes appears in the note below.

confidential, kagep-kahof: Druokax Systems plans to lower the Ulaath list price by 53 percent in March.